How they compare
Laos currently reports 61.5% against 61.3% in Ireland, a difference of 0.2%.
Across all 7 years both countries report, Laos has been ahead every year.
Ireland ranks 50th and Laos ranks 49th of 194 countries.
Laos has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Ireland | Laos |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 39.9% | 80.3% | 40.3% | Laos |
| 2000s | 50.3% | 80.3% | 30.1% | Laos |
| 2010s | 55.3% | 69.9% | 14.7% | Laos |
| 2020s | 59.4% | 61.5% | 2.1% | Laos |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
